CCTV captured car being driven off after collision
CCTV footage has captured the moment a car was driven into the back of a parked vehicle before reversing and being driven away.
The incident happened at 9.40pm on April 22 at Trefelin Crescent, in Port Talbot.
The owner of the Mercedes that was hit, who has asked not to be named, said she didn’t realise what had happened to her car until the following morning.
She then checked her CCTV and was left shocked after seeing the driver, who she said was also behind the wheel of a Mercedes, flee the scene.
“It’s so frustrating because there’s a claim now on my insurance for no fault of my own, I wasn’t in the vehicle, it was parked outside my property. The back bumper has split, the side panel damaged, all the light has been smashed.
“It’s a shame, I’m the innocent party, yet it’s my premium that will be hit, the person involved hasn’t had the decency to stop and knock the door. “
The 47-year-old said people in the area had heard the bump when the car collided with hers.
“There must be damage to their vehicle. You can hear the bump. We’ve got a page and people commented on there roughly about the time it happened, ‘did anyone hear that bang, sounds like a car hitting a car.’ I must have nodded off on the settee and didn’t hear it. I didn’t see it until the morning.
“I just want people to be aware that this is happening and people are getting away with it,” she
said.
A spokeswoman for South Wales Police said: “South Wales Police received a call at 9.54am on Friday, April 23, following a report of a car driving into a parked car on Trefelin
Crescent at around 9.40pm on Thursday, April 22.
“Anyone with information is asked to contact South Wales Police, quoting occurrence number 2100140778.”
